Fedotova and Others v. Russia: Dawn of a new era for European LGBTQ families?
Nausica Palazzo
Abstract:The judgment of the Grand Chamber in the case of Fedotova and Others v. Russia has recognized the right to legalized same-sex unions under the Convention, thereby significantly impacting LGBTQ rights throughout Europe. However, this decision also presents intricate challenges concerning the Court's legitimacy, and resilience amidst the prevailing culture wars on LGBTQ rights.
